Summary
Patient Information Reconciliation extends Scheduled Workflow by providing the means to match images acquired for an unidentified patient (for example, during a trauma case) with the patient's registration and order history. In the example of the trauma case, this allows subsequent reconciliation of the patient record with images acquired (either without a prior registration or under a generic registration) before the patient's identity could be determined.
Benefits
Enabling after-the-fact matching greatly simplifies exception-handling situations.
